英文摘要In this paper, the adaptive control problem is studied for discrete-time stochastic bilinear systems with correlated noises and unknown parameters. A new adaptive control scheme, which is the ELS-based adaptive tracker of the studied systems, is proposed according to the modified certainty equivalence principle. By using the algorithm, the given bounded reference signal can be tracked by the resulting closed-loop system's output, the global stability of the designed adaptive tracking system is proved. And, the estimates of the unknown parameters are obtained with the strong consistency. The good tracking effect and parameter estimating performance of the proposed algorithm are presented in the two simulation examples.. (Abstract)
